What Is Vegan Leather?
Vegan leather is a premium material crafted without the use of animal hides. Modern vegan leather is produced from innovative materials including polyurethane (PU), PiΓ±atex (pineapple fibre), and other plant-based alternatives β each offering exceptional durability, texture, and finish.
How Does It Compare?
Premium vegan leather is virtually indistinguishable from traditional leather to the touch. It is water-resistant, easy to maintain, and β crucially β produced without harm to animals or the significant environmental impact of traditional tanning processes.
